6. Affordable RV Camping Options
Budget travelers can still enjoy Waco without breaking the bank. Many RV campgrounds offer nightly rates under $40, along with discounts for extended stays or memberships like Good Sam Club and Passport America.
7. Attractions Near RV Parks in Waco TX
What makes Waco special is the wealth of attractions within a short drive from most RV parks.
Magnolia Market at the Silos
Made famous by HGTV’s Fixer Upper, this shopping and dining hub attracts thousands of visitors each year.
Cameron Park Zoo
A great family-friendly destination with over 1,700 animals across 52 acres.
Baylor University Landmarks
Explore the campus and visit the Mayborn Museum or McLane Stadium for a mix of history and sports.

9. Seasonal RV Camping Tips
- Spring: Ideal for wildflowers and festivals.
- Summer: Expect higher temperatures; choose RV parks with pools.
- Fall: Perfect for football season and cooler camping.
- Winter: Mild weather makes it a great off-season escape.

13. RV Camping Costs and Budgeting
On average, RV parks in Waco TX charge:
- $30–$50 per night (standard sites)
- $50–$80 per night (premium resorts)
Long-term stays often come with discounts, making extended travel affordable.
